IEDR Publish 2012 Domain Figures

IEDR have published their latest annual report which covers the period up to the end of 2012. Here’s a few of the highlights: Renewal rate of 86% Total .ie domains at year-end of 182,284, up 5.3% year-on-year New .ie domain registrations down 15% on 2011 By way of comparison the .no domain registry (Norway) currently… Continue reading IEDR Publish 2012 Domain Figures

ccTLD Registries Under Attack?

In the past 24 hours both the .nl domain registry and .be domain registry have been attacked. The .be registry‘s public facing website was defaced, though the defacement had no impact on the registry data. As would be expected the registry data is not linked to the public facing website. IEDR Appoint New Registration Services Team Lead

IEDR announced earlier today that Paul Shortt has been appointed Supervisor of the Registration Services team. Effectively the role is manager of the registration services team which handle the day to day operations handling new registrations, updates and transfers of .ie domain names. Belgian Country Code Now Supports IDN

Earlier this week dns.be launched IDNs (internationalised domain names). The Belgian registry opted to support the accented characters for Dutch, French and German. In so doing they’ve also ended up providing support for other European languages, such as Swedish, Finnish and Danish. More Premium Domains Released by ME Registry

The .me registry held back a bunch of domain names when they went live a couple of years back. They’ve been releasing some of them via auctions, while others have been made available to companies who were able to submit a project plan to the Montenegrin company.
